Douglas Royal and and Ramsey will contest the Isle of Man Women's FA Cup final after both sides won their respective semi-finals on Sunday.
Royal secured their passage to a seventh final appearance with a 5-2 victory over their Ballafletcher neighbours and holders Corinthians.
Meanwhile, Ramsey secured their first ever major cup final appearance by defeating Gymns 4-2 on penalties.
The game had finished 2-2 after full-time and 3-3 after extra-time.
The sides will meet in the final on Sunday, 8 May 2011.
As the Bowl is still being redeveloped the venue is still to be confirmed by the Isle of Man FA.
